summ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--services/core/java/com/android/server/pm/PackageInstallerSession.java16
1 files changed, 0 insertions, 16 deletions
diff --git a/services/core/java/com/android/server/pm/PackageInstallerSession.java b/services/core/java/com/android/server/pm/PackageInstallerSession.java
index 06458d1bf50c..37bfbb11948a 100644
--- a/services/core/java/com/android/server/pm/PackageInstallerSession.java
+++ b/services/core/java/com/android/server/pm/PackageInstallerSession.java
@@ -366,14 +366,6 @@ public class PackageInstallerSession extends IPackageInstallerSession.Stub {
@GuardedBy("mLock")
private boolean mStageDirInUse = false;
- /**
- * True if the installation is already in progress. This is used to prevent the caller
- * from {@link #commit(IntentSender, boolean) committing} the session again while the
- * installation is still in progress.
- */
- @GuardedBy("mLock")
- private boolean mInstallationInProgress = false;
-
/** Permissions have been accepted by the user (see {@link #setPermissionsResult}) */
@GuardedBy("mLock")
private boolean mPermissionsManuallyAccepted = false;
@@ -1669,14 +1661,6 @@ public class PackageInstallerSession extends IPackageInstallerSession.Stub {
}
}
- synchronized (mLock) {
- if (mInstallationInProgress) {
- throw new IllegalStateException("Installation is already in progress. Don't "
- + "commit session=" + sessionId + " again.");
- }
- mInstallationInProgress = true;
- }
-
dispatchSessionSealed();
}